Quick report

We rode up Seattle Ridge with the goal of digging mid and high elevation pits and looking for natural avalanche activity. Flat light and poor visibility made travel challenging. Although we hoped to get a look at Warm Up Bowl and areas farther south along the ridge, we stuck to Main Bowl where there are more trees. The only recent avalanche activity we observed was a couple of loose wet avalanches in Main Bowl, but poor visibility limited how much of the Seattle Ridge riding area we could see.

At 1,800 ft we found about 4 inches of new snow. In more sheltered areas above 2,500 ft, we found 5 to 6 inches of fresh snow.

We dug our first pit next to the Seattle Uptrack on a southeast aspect at 1,800 ft and found a mostly moist snowpack. While none of the snow was fully saturated, many of the faceted layers were rounding and moistening. Without digging on a northerly aspect at this elevation, it is difficult to say whether the snowpack is healing across all aspects. However, we also dug on a less sun-affected aspect at 2,800 ft and found a very different setup.

In our upper elevation pit on an east aspect at 2,800 ft, we found mostly dry snow. We could clearly identify all the facet layers we have been tracking since the beginning of the season. The snow remained mostly dry beneath the recent storm snow, and the structure matched our observations from the past couple of weeks. While neither pit produced concerning test results, weak layers persist at mid and upper elevations, and the most concerning layer in our pits is facets above and below an early February melt freeze crust.

Trail conditions are still soft and grippy, but a few sections of dirt are present in the treed section of the uptrack.

Overcast with light snowfall in the late afternoon, continuing until we left at 3:30 PM.

Snowpack

We dug snowpits at two elevations and aspects and found very different snowpacks. In our first pit at 1,800 ft on a southeast aspect near the Seattle Ridge uptrack, we found mostly rounded grains and moist, rounding facets. Layers were becoming more difficult to distinguish, and most of the snowpack was moist. In the upper foot, we observed a percolation column extending about 1 ft into the snow, forming a new melt freeze crust. Our nearest surface facet layer consisted of moist, rounded facets about 1.5 ft down, sitting above the February 10 crust, but Extended Column Tests did not produce unstable results.

We dug our second snowpit in a small stand of trees at 2,800 ft above Main Bowl. We found about 4 inches of new snow at this slightly wind-affected location, sitting on top of a breakable melt freeze crust. Below this crust, we identified multiple intact early April and March facet layers, as well as facets above and below the February 10 melt freeze crust. The snowpack at this location resembled a midwinter structure. Although valley bottoms are melting and conditions are starting to feel like spring, the snowpack at elevation still resembles a midwinter pack with poor structure, and although we did not have unstable results at these locations, we will continue to track these layers.
